“…A higher volume of ethyl alcohol interfered with the indicator electrode system because of changes in solution conductance. According to Prokopov (8), mercury(II) decomposes sodium tetraphenylboron. Further, only NH4+, AgT, T1+, Rb + ions and anions interfer with the potassium determination in dilute nitric acid medium.…”
